SPARC
Sport & Recreation New Zealand (SPARC) is the Government’s sport agency and is ESNZ’s largest external funding contributor, providing approximately $1,000,000 in outcome-based investment during the 2009-10 financial year. A large majority of this funding is for High Performance (specifically for Eventing) but also includes Sports Development and Coach Development support. SPARC works closely with ESNZ offering additional services such as governance and management courses as well as advice in a range of areas. ESNZ has a strong relationship with SPARC and appreciates their continued support of so many of our programmes.
NZAS
The New Zealand Academy of Sport is SPARC’s high performance services provider. ESNZ receives significant benefit from its close relationship with both the North and South Island academies. NZAS staff are regularly involved with improving our high performance programme including setting of individual targets, increasing the integration of the best sports science advice and improving equine health standards.
Halberg Trust
ESNZ is grateful to The Halberg Trust for its support of our Para-Equestrian programme, one of only four sports to receive such support via SPARC’s No Exceptions strategy. The Halberg Trust investment enables ESNZ to increase participation levels of riders with disabilities in our sport.
